Microsoft Access is an information base administration framework (DBMS) from Microsoft that consolidates the Relational Access Database Engine (ACE) with a graphical UI and programming advancement apparatuses. It is an individual from the Microsoft 365 set-up of utilizations, remembered for Professional and higher adaptations or sold independently.
Microsoft Access stores information in its own arrangement in view of the Access Database Engine (previously the Jet Database Engine). It can likewise straightforwardly import or connect information put away in different applications and data sets.
Programming designers, information modelers, and power clients can utilize Microsoft Access to foster application programming. Like other Microsoft Office applications, Access is upheld by Visual Basic for Applications (VBA), an article based programming language that can reference an assortment of items, including inheritance DAOs (Data Access Objects), ActiveX information objects, and numerous other ActiveX parts. . , Visual items utilized in structures and reports uncover their strategies and properties to the VBA programming climate, and VBA code modules can announce and call Windows working framework tasks. Get guidance on many topics on HowTat.
History
Prior to the presentation of Access, Borland (with Paradox and dBase) and Fox (with FoxPro) ruled the work area data set market. Microsoft Access was the main mass-market information base program for Windows. With the acquisition of FoxPro by Microsoft in 1992 and the expansion of Fox’s Rushmore question advancement routine to Access, Microsoft Access immediately turned into the prevailing information base for Windows – actually finishing the opposition that had progressed from the MS-DOS world.
Project Omega
Microsoft’s most memorable endeavor to sell a social information base item was during the 1980s when Microsoft got a permit to sell R: Base. In the last part of the 1980s, Microsoft fostered its own answer codenamed Omega. In 1988 it was affirmed that an information base item for Windows and OS/2 was being developed. This was to incorporate the “EB” Embedded BASIC language, which would turn into the language for composing macros in all Microsoft applications, however, the mix of large-scale dialects didn’t happen until the presentation of Visual Basic for Applications (VBA). Hui. Omega was additionally expected to give the front finish to Microsoft SQL Server. The application was very asset hungry, and there were reports that it was running gradually on the 386 processors accessible at that point. It was to be delivered in the main quarter of 1990, however, in 1989 the advancement of the item was reset and it was rescheduled to be circulated sooner than in January 1991. Portions of the venture were subsequently utilized for other Microsoft projects: Cirrus (codename for Access) and Thunder (codename for Visual Basic, where the Embedded BASIC motor was utilized). Following the debut of Access, the Omega Project was exhibited to a few writers in 1992 and included highlights that were not accessible in Access. Also, check out how to remove table formatting in excel.
Project Cirrus
After the Omega project was ended, a portion of its designers was allocated to the Cyrus project (most were relegated to the group that made Visual Basic). Its objective was to make a contender to applications, for example, Paradox or dBase that would deal with Windows. After FoxPro was procured by Microsoft, there were tales that Microsoft Project may be supplanted with it, however, the organization chose to foster them in equal. It was accepted that the task would utilize the Extensible Storage Engine (Jet Blue), however, eventually, support was accommodated just the Jet Database Engine (Jet Red). The venture utilized some code from both the Omega project and the pre-discharge renditions of Visual Basic. In July 1992, betas of Cirrus were delivered to engineers and the Access name turned into the authority name of the item. “Access” was initially utilized for Microsoft’s more established terminal imitating program. Years after the program was deserted, they chose to reuse the name here.
Use
As well as utilizing its own information base capacity record, Microsoft Access can likewise be utilized as the ‘front-finish’ of the program, while different items go about as the ‘back-nightstands, like Microsoft SQL Server and non-Microsoft items like Oracle and Sybase. Numerous backend sources can be utilized by Microsoft Access Jet information bases (ACCDB and MDB designs). Essentially, a few applications like Visual Basic, ASP.NET, or Visual Studio .NET will utilize the Microsoft Access data set design for their tables and inquiries. Microsoft Access can likewise be important for a more intricate arrangement, where it tends to be incorporated with different advancements, for example, Microsoft Excel, Microsoft Outlook, Microsoft Word, Microsoft PowerPoint, and ActiveX controls.
Access tables support an assortment of standard field types, records, and referential trustworthiness including flowing updates and erases. Access has an inquiry interface, and structures for showing and entering information.